How to use Spore cheat codes
To use Spore cheat codes, press Ctrl+Shift+C to open the console screen then type your selection from the following commands into the console and hit enter. Press Escape or click on the X to close the console when you’re done.
Spore cheat codes list
- moreMoney – get $2,000 in civilisation and $1,000,000 in space
- refillMotives – replenish your health along with other motives
- addDNA – get 150 DNA points
- unlockSuperWeapons – super weapons are unlocked
- spaceCreate – unlocks and recharges creation tools while playing in space
- freedom [on/off]– disables (on) or re-enables (off) editor complexity limits, creations that break the limits will not be pollinated
- evoadvantage – enter this cheat when are starting a new Creature game to choose any creature from the Sporepedia, so you can start a new game with one of your more evolved creatures
- levels -unlock – enter at the main menu to unlock all stages, some achievements may not be gained if you choose to use this code
- levels -unlockAdventures – enter at the main menu to unlock all Maxis adventures
- SetTime [h, m]– set the time for your Avatar’s position, and optionally a speed multiplier
- universeSimulatorPirateRaidFrequency # – set the rate that pirates will raid your system
- universeSimulatorPirateRaidAllyFrequency # – set the rate that pirates will raid allies in your system
- universeSimulatorPirateRaidPlunderFrequency # – set the rate that pirates will steal spice from your system
